Why the Demand for Turbo Tournaments?

Casual poker players often have 45–90 minutes, not four hours. Traditional deep‑stack tournaments require patience, endurance, and the ability to navigate many blind levels. Turbo tournaments collapse that timeline: blinds increase every five to eight minutes, stack‑to‑blind ratios shrink fast, and decisions become push‑fold scenarios early. The search for “fast poker” and “quick tournament” reflects a genuine need to fit poker into a busy life. Yet the same speed that attracts players also amplifies variance and punishes simple mistakes.

What Turbo Poker Tournaments Really Are

A turbo tournament is defined by its blind structure – typically levels last 5–8 minutes, starting stacks are smaller relative to the big blind (often 30–50 big blinds), and antes kick in sooner. On platforms such as AO88, the turbo format is offered alongside deep‑stack and hyper‑turbo variants. The selling point is clear: you can finish a tournament in roughly the time it takes to watch a football half. But the compressed structure leaves little room for post‑flop creativity. Hand reading becomes secondary to push‑fold math, and survival often hinges on winning a few coin flips.

A Walk Through a Turbo Tournament on AO88

Picture a $10 buy‑in turbo with 200 players. You start with 1,500 chips, blinds 10/20. Level one is playable – you can limp or raise small. By level three (blinds 30/60) your stack is already 25 big blinds. The typical player either doubles up or becomes desperate. At the bubble, with 30 players left, the average stack might be 10 blinds. Every hand is a shove or fold. The urgency forces constant risk‑reward calculations, but it also magnifies luck. A skilled short‑stack player can thrive; a patient post‑flop expert may feel suffocated.

Early Levels: The Illusion of Control

In the first two levels, you can still play a range of hands and see flops. But any chip loss cuts deep because the blinds climb quickly. Aggressive stealing from late position becomes vital. Most recreational players make the mistake of calling raises with marginal hands, hoping to “see a flop,” and then losing half their stack. The disciplined player folds, re‑steals, or shoves with a solid hand.

Middle to Bubble: All‑In Poker

Once blinds exceed 100, the tournament transforms. ICM pressure is severe – a double‑up is critical, but a bust leaves you with nothing. The correct play often involves shoving any ace, any pair, or any two broadway cards from late position. Calling ranges must be tight. This is where the turbo format separates those who have studied push‑fold charts from those who rely on intuition. Many players find this phase exhilarating, but it can also feel like pure gambling.

Heads‑Up

With only two players left, the effective stack is usually below 10 blinds. The match becomes a shoving contest. Slight edges in hand selection matter, but luck still plays a significant role. Players who dislike high‑variance outcomes often prefer the relative sanity of deep‑stack heads‑up play.

Risks Every Turbo Player Should Check

From a risk‑management perspective, turbo tournaments demand a different mindset. Here is what you need to verify before committing real money:

  • Blind structure details: How long are levels? Do they include antes? A 5‑minute level with ante is far more aggressive than a 7‑minute level without. Always check the tournament lobby on your platform.
  • Starting stack to big blind ratio: If you start with only 30 big blinds, you are effectively short‑stacked from hand one. That suits a shove‑fold specialist but not a multi‑street player.
  • Registration period and late registration: Late reg in turbos gives a huge advantage because you can enter with a fresh stack when others are short. But it also means you miss the early levels where you could accumulate cheaply.
  • Variance tolerance: Even a strong turbo player will experience long downswings. Ask yourself whether you can afford to lose your buy‑in several times in a row without tilting.
  • Time commitment: A turbo tournament may finish faster, but if you multi‑table you could still spend two hours per session. Manage your schedule accordingly.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is turbo poker more profitable than deep‑stack?

It depends on your skill set. If you are proficient at short‑stack strategy and can withstand higher variance, turbos can have a higher hourly rate because they end faster. But the edge is smaller due to increased luck factor.

Can beginners play turbo tournaments?

Beginners can play, but they will likely lose money faster. Without understanding push‑fold ranges and ICM, turbos become nearly random. It is better to start with deep‑stack cash games or slow tournaments to learn post‑flop play.

What bankroll is recommended for turbo tournaments?

A general guideline is at least 100 buy‑ins for the stakes you play, because variance is high. For a $10 turbo, that means a bankroll of $1,000 dedicated to tournaments. This is not financial advice, only a common risk‑management rule.

How can I improve my turbo game?

Study push‑fold charts, practice with free online tools, and review your tournament hands focusing on bubble and blind‑vs‑blind situations. Avoid playing when tired – turbo requires constant sharp decisions.

Final Recommendations by Player Group

Not every poker enthusiast belongs in a turbo tournament. Based on the risk profile and playing style, here is a practical breakdown:

  • Experienced tournament grinders – You already understand ICM, short‑stack play, and variance. Turbos on AO88 offer a way to grind more tournaments per session and increase hourly win rate. Use them as part of a balanced schedule.
  • Recreational players with limited time – If you only have one hour and want the thrill of a tournament finish, turbos are enjoyable. Keep buy‑ins low and consider them entertainment rather than income.
  • Deep‑stack enthusiasts – If you love post‑flop maneuvering and outplaying opponents over many streets, turbos will frustrate you. Stick to deep‑stack or standard structures where skill has more room.
  • Beginners – Avoid turbos until you have a solid grasp of preflop ranges and bubble strategy. The fast pace will accelerate losses without offering learning opportunities.
  • Emotionally vulnerable players – Turbos can trigger tilt quickly because bad beats end your tournament in minutes. If you have trouble letting go of short‑term losses, choose slower formats.
